從3個方面聊聊,如何正確使用需求池?
參與到項目中,經(jīng)常發(fā)現(xiàn)項目的需求源源不斷,剛做完一堆需求,馬上又有新的需求要做,感覺總是做不完,就像一個“無底洞”。實際上,這里涉及到一個需求管理的概念。項目中哪些該做,哪些不該做,做到什么程度,都是由需求管理的過程來決定的。而需求管理可以通過需求池進行維護跟蹤。
需求池概念
1. 使用場景
在項目工作中,經(jīng)常會碰到客戶說我之前給你們提了一個某某需求,怎么還沒有上線。然后產(chǎn)品經(jīng)理根本就沒有找到該需求的任何記錄??蛻舻耐院艽螅芏鄷r候都不記得曾經(jīng)說過什么。這個時候就需要有一個通過信息記錄,幫助客戶找回需求記憶。
在實際工作中,產(chǎn)品經(jīng)理每天都會面臨各種各樣的需求,如果僅憑大腦記憶而沒有及時記錄下來,就容易產(chǎn)生需求信息丟失。此時需求池就是一個很好的工具,產(chǎn)品經(jīng)理可以隨時記錄各個來源傳遞過來的需求,以防需求或者關(guān)鍵信息遺漏。
需求池作為需求管理的一個容器,相當(dāng)于需求的數(shù)據(jù)庫,為需求分析提供數(shù)據(jù)來源。需求池一般采用最簡單的Excel,原因是簡單、易管理。這里不僅僅是簡單記錄需求是什么,還會記錄這個需求相關(guān)的一些關(guān)鍵要素。比如用戶(who)在什么模塊(where)遇到什么問題(what),希望達到什么效果(how)。
需求池的維護原則是寬進嚴(yán)出,“寬進”主要是因為需求池面對的產(chǎn)品經(jīng)理或者產(chǎn)品部門,是需求的備忘錄,所以需要把所有的需求都應(yīng)該放到池子里。而“嚴(yán)出”則是需求池的需求需要經(jīng)過篩選、分析、規(guī)劃之后,才正式從需求池進行到后續(xù)的需求文檔中安排開發(fā)。
2. 需求池屬性
需求池的模板參考上圖,需求池的關(guān)鍵屬性說明如下:
(1)編號
編號就是需求池的順序號,主要是需求的唯一性標(biāo)識。通常情況下,項目中會有多個業(yè)務(wù)系統(tǒng),每個系統(tǒng)單獨維護一個需求跟蹤表,需求編號的命名規(guī)則即為:系統(tǒng)英文簡稱_OR(原始需求縮寫)_順序號。
(2)功能模塊
把需求劃分到系統(tǒng)的某個功能模塊,由于需求池的需求還未經(jīng)過進一步的分析,一般只需要劃分到系統(tǒng)的一級菜單。
(3)需求類型
需求類型一般包括:新增功能、功能改進、需求變更、界面優(yōu)化、Bug修復(fù)、刪除功能、接口需求等。
- 新增功能:已發(fā)布版本中尚未包含的功能。
- 功能改進:對已發(fā)布功能做可用性、易用性的改進,比如性能優(yōu)化、架構(gòu)優(yōu)化等。
- 需求變更:相對新增需求而言,提出方的需求發(fā)生改變,原來的需求變更為“刪除需求”狀態(tài),并記錄關(guān)聯(lián)關(guān)系。
- 界面優(yōu)化:UI層面的改動,如按鈕顏色。
- BUG修復(fù):系統(tǒng)上線之后,反饋回來的Bug視為需求統(tǒng)一管理。
- 刪除功能:去除已發(fā)布的功能。
- 接口需求:我方是數(shù)據(jù)使用方,使用對方提供的接口,和我方是數(shù)據(jù)提供方,提供接口供對方使用。
(4)需求名稱
用簡潔的短提煉出用戶的訴求。比如:文本框搜索框支持點擊鍵盤Enter鍵觸發(fā)查詢功能。
(5)用戶故事
我們要明確用戶是在什么場景下,為了完成什么目標(biāo)而需要做什么任務(wù)。即要從場景、目標(biāo)和任務(wù)這三方面去具象化需求。
比如場景:針對查詢申請單,查詢專員發(fā)現(xiàn)運營商反饋的文件不對;任務(wù):支持在原來的查詢單上重新發(fā)起查詢請求,以便運營商接收到新的指令,可以再次反饋文件;目標(biāo):運營商根據(jù)查詢申請單反饋正確的文件。
(6)優(yōu)先級
需求的優(yōu)先級可以根據(jù)需求重要性:核心需求、基本需求、建議需求和需求的緊迫性:非常緊迫、一般緊迫、無緊迫性這兩個方便來定義出三個等級:高、中、低。
(7)提出人
需求的提出者,有疑惑時便于追溯,負責(zé)解釋需求。
(8)提出時間
原始需求的提出時間,輔助信息。
(9)關(guān)聯(lián)需求
該需求和需求池中哪些需求有關(guān)聯(lián),一般在需求分析的時候需要參考的相關(guān)信息。
比如:同一個需求,但是不同從不同用戶采集的信息不一致,或者多個用戶對同一個需求信息的表達觀點矛盾,那么這個就要用到關(guān)聯(lián)性編號。比如A用戶希望登錄的時候,需要選擇當(dāng)前用戶的所屬機構(gòu),用戶名和密碼。B用戶建議登錄的時候,直接通過用戶名和密碼即可。這2個需求,就是關(guān)聯(lián)需求。
(10)需求來源
需求的來源主要包括:用戶調(diào)研、競品分析、運營反饋、領(lǐng)導(dǎo)意見等。
- 用戶調(diào)研:通過用戶訪談收集需求,可以是面對面溝通,也可以通過微信、QQ、電話等方式獲取信息。
- 競品分析:通過在市面上找到同類競爭產(chǎn)品,深入體驗競品功能,為產(chǎn)品設(shè)計及需求收集尋求思路。
- 運營反饋:產(chǎn)品上線后,運營同學(xué)會把用戶在使用過程中會發(fā)出反饋的吐槽的或者建議的信息,反饋給產(chǎn)品經(jīng)理。
- 領(lǐng)導(dǎo)意見:實際工作中經(jīng)常會遇到老板一句話的需求,這些需求往往來自于老板身處的高度和豐富的工作經(jīng)驗。
(11)需求狀態(tài)
隨著產(chǎn)品的進展,需求的生命周期會以不同的狀態(tài)標(biāo)識,比如:待討論、需求中、開發(fā)中、已發(fā)布、暫緩、取消。
- 待討論:剛剛提出或尚未討論或技術(shù)尚未確認(rèn)的需求。
- 需求中:已完成排期的需求。
- 開發(fā)中:已經(jīng)進入開發(fā)或尚未發(fā)布的需求。
- 已發(fā)布:已經(jīng)發(fā)布的需求。
- 暫緩:討論完成尚未排期的需求。
- 取消:無效需求。
(12)開發(fā)版本
在經(jīng)過后續(xù)的需求排期之后,記錄原始需求是在哪個版本開始實現(xiàn)的。
(13)備注
其它任何信息,如:
- 被拒絕的理由;
- 被暫緩的理由和重啟條件;
- 其它相關(guān)文檔。
3. 如何正確記錄一個需求
在產(chǎn)品經(jīng)理的日常工作中,我們來看一個需求采集的場景。
當(dāng)產(chǎn)品正在畫原型的時候,發(fā)現(xiàn)電腦右下角的QQ圖像閃爍,打開對話框,看到運營同學(xué)發(fā)過來的消息,進行如下對話。
需求溝通之后,產(chǎn)品經(jīng)理需要及時把信息記錄到需求池中,以防需求信息的遺漏。而且在需求記錄的過程中,還能再次梳理需求,進一步挖掘需求信息,為后面做需求分析和設(shè)計提供重要依據(jù)。
通過維護一個健康的需求池,我們給需求提出者一種信息反饋,就是他們的需求我們都重視了,已經(jīng)放到了需求池當(dāng)中,但是是否安排給開發(fā)需要根據(jù)所有需求進行“輕重緩急”的權(quán)重比較才能決定。這樣可以及時給相關(guān)人員反饋需求排期和進度。
總結(jié)
需求池其實就是信息傳遞的載體,還可以為后續(xù)需求變更提供信息依據(jù),也便于領(lǐng)導(dǎo)或者相關(guān)人及時了解需求狀態(tài),了解產(chǎn)品的整體情況,了解每個迭代版本完成了哪些需求,便于產(chǎn)品進行進度把控和需求驗收。
由于市場環(huán)境,用戶行為都有可能發(fā)生變化,這個時間段的需求有可能過一段時間就失去意義了;或者之前暫緩的需求,在目前的市場環(huán)境和產(chǎn)品情況下,該需求的緊迫優(yōu)先級變高了,需要納入到下一版本的需求排期。故需求池需要產(chǎn)品經(jīng)理定期梳理,每次安排產(chǎn)品版本計劃的時候都要重新審視一遍需求,對所有的需求再次進行分析和篩選,進行需求優(yōu)先級的定義。
本文由 @瓜子 原創(chuàng)發(fā)布于人人都是產(chǎn)品經(jīng)理,未經(jīng)作者許可,禁止轉(zhuǎn)載。
題圖來自Unsplash,基于CC0協(xié)議。
學(xué)習(xí)了!